Christian Gottlob Heyne (1729-1812) was the most famous classical scholar of his generation and in his extensive oeuvre frequently dealt with topics of ancient history. Besides his own historical researches and numerous reviews communicating the results of international scholarship, there are his attempts to make the knowledge of antiquity fruitful for the modern world. Using a wide variety of material, this book aims to present Heyne's treatment of ancient history in relation to his studies in philology, mythology, antiquities and archaeology, and to determine how this treatment relates to the scholarly or political debate of his time.
